
Funerals and memorial Services
Local ministers are available to conduct funerals at any of our Churches across the benefice or at a local Crematorium.
Booking for a funeral service is usually made via one of the local Funeral Directors. The minister conducting the service will meet with the family to discuss the arrangements and help shape the service in response to the family’s wishes.
All of our churchyards are open for burials of anyone living in the parish, those on the church electoral roll, and those who die within the parish boundaries. See New Burials and Memorials for more information.
Memorial Services are held sometime after the funeral and often on a particular anniversary. Memorials are sometimes held when signifcant members of the family were unable to be in attendance at the funeral. A Note on Churchyards
Our churchyards have limited space and so ordinarily only residents of the parish are eligible to be buried or interred in the churchyard. However if the person used to live in the parish, or had a strong family connection to the parish, the PCC may be willing to consider making an exception.
